Understanding Apple App Site Association
The Apple App Site Association (AASA) file is a crucial component for developers looking to facilitate seamless user experiences between their websites and iOS applications. This JSON file tells iOS devices which parts of the app can be opened directly from the web, ensuring that users can navigate and interact with the app in a frictionless manner. Essentially, it acts as a bridge, enhancing how users engage with apps while also improving SEO for the associated website.
Creating an effective AASA file requires a precise understanding of its structure and requirements. Developers must ensure that the file is correctly hosted on their server and adheres to Apple’s specifications. This involves correct MIME type settings and ensuring the file is accessible over HTTPS. Failure to comply can result in the app losing its deep-linking capabilities, which can significantly impact user engagement and retention.

Best SSDs for Gaming Laptops
When it comes to gaming laptops, the performance of the storage solution is just as critical as the graphics card or CPU. The best SSDs for gaming laptops provide a significant boost in load times and overall responsiveness, making them a must-have for any serious gamer. When selecting an SSD, gamers should consider speed, capacity, and reliability to ensure a smooth gaming experience.
The market is saturated with options, but a few stand out for their exceptional performance. For instance, NVMe SSDs offer remarkable read and write speeds that can significantly decrease load times and improve in-game performance. These drives connect directly to the motherboard and bypass traditional SATA connections, leading to faster data transfer rates. Gamers looking for performance should definitely consider NVMe options for their laptops.
Another essential consideration is storage capacity. Modern games can take up substantial amounts of space, often exceeding 100GB each. Therefore, investing in SSDs with larger capacities, such as 1TB or more, is advisable for avid gamers. This ensures that there is ample room not just for the games themselves but also for updates and additional content that often accompanies popular titles.
